# Break-Glass: Catalog Cache Invalidation

Scope: the Pinrow product catalog at Veldstone Retail. If stale prices persist after a purge and the Hollowmere invalidation queue is wedged, use break-glass to flush the edge tier directly. Contractors: get verbal sign-off from the catalog lead first. Steps: open the Hollowmere admin shell, select emergency-flush, confirm the tenant, and run it once — repeated flushes thrash the origin. Access is logged and expires after 20 minutes. Unseal the admin shell with the passphrase below.

recovery phrase for kahop-tajog: istix-casvan

**Vendor note: Inkmill markdown pipeline**

Rendering for Parchway docs is outsourced to Inkmill under an annual contract, renewing each March. They handle sanitization and PDF export; we own the upload queue. SLA: 4-hour response on rendering failures. Escalate only after two failed retries. Their support desk is reachable at the address below.

billing contact of hahaf-baguf = zorael.tammir.jorius@sivrelhq.internal

Team assistants —

After-hours server room access changes tonight. The old keypad on B2 is disabled. Anyone needing entry after 19:00 must sign the log at the front desk first — no exceptions. Escort rules still apply for vendors. Facilities audits the log weekly. Use the new after-hours code below.

— Front Desk, Quarrington House

staff pass of kawip-hawef = bdg-QLP-2